Xthetic® hot

Short-term, heat-cured denture base resin for the packing/pressing technique

Denture base resin, heat-curing. Acrylic resin for the fabrication of removable or fixed dentures using the packing/pressing technique as well as the injection technique.

Indications

  • Fabrication of full or partial dentures using the packing/pressing technique
  • Fabrication of full or partial dentures using the injection technique

Mixing ratio:
10g of powder with 4g of liquid

Processing times:
Swelling phase: approx. 10 min
Processing phase (packing/pressing): approx. 30 min
Processing phase (injection): approx. 5 min

Polymerization:
The material is polymerized in boiling water for about 20 minutes.

Shades:
The material is available in colorless/clear, pink, pink V (veined), pink TL (translucent), pink TLV (translucent veined), pink opaque, V5 and pink C34.

Note:
Medical Device. Classification according to ISO 20795-1, Type 1 group 1 and according to MDD 93/42/EEC Annex IX, Class IIa for removable and for fixed dentures.


mechanical properties acc. to ISO 20795-1 Requirements Xthetic® hot
Ultimate flexural strength in MPa min. 65 80
Flexural modulus in MPa min. 2000 2700
Maximum stress intensity factor in MPa not required -
Total fracture work in J/m² not required -
additional properties acc. to ISO 20795-1 Requirements Xthetic® hot
Water absorption in μg/mm³ max. 32 23
Solubility in μg/mm³ max. 1,6 0,6
Residual monomer in % max. 2,2 0,8
other requirements Xthetic® hot
ISO 20795-1 Requirements concerning the packing plasticity fulfilled
ISO 20795-1 Requirements concerning the surface characteristics and the shape capability fulfilled
ISO 20795-1 Requirements concerning the color and the color stability fulfilled
ISO 20795-1 Requirements concerning the translucency and the freedom from porosity fulfilled
ISO 20795-1 Requirements concerning the bonding to synthetic polymer teeth fulfilled
ISO 10993 Requirements concerning the biocompatibility fulfilled
